LOT DETAILS
Titled "Mount Norquay", signed lower right, dated September 29, 1976 verso (760929), oil on panel, 30.5 x 40.6cm (12 x 16in); Provenance: Aggregation Gallery, Toronto; Doris Jean McCarthy, Canadian, 1910-2010; born in Calgary, Doris attended the Ontario College of Art from 1926-1930, and became a teacher at the Central Technical School in Toronto from 1933 until she retired in 1972; Mount Norquay is located in Banff National Park, southwestern Alberta
